Frequently Asked Questions (FAQs)

What is the process of gas nitriding?
Gas nitriding is a surface hardening treatment applied to steel parts. It works by heating the part in an atmosphere rich in nitrogen so that nitrogen can go into the outer layer of the metal. This hardens the surface and makes it more wear-resistant, but leaves the inside of the part mostly unchanged. Customers usually look for this process when they want better part life without major distortion.
Gas nitriding usually takes several hours, and for deeper cases it can take much longer. Some work might take a few hours to complete, while others might take many hours or even up to around 100 hours, depending on the material and depth required. Timing depends on the part. Gas nitriding is done at a relatively low heat-treatment temperature, usually around 500 to 590 degrees centigrade, or roughly 950 to 1050 degrees Fahrenheit. This lower temperature is one reason many customers choose it, because it helps reduce warping and size change in finished parts. It is a controlled process, not a high-heat one.
Nitriding increases surface hardness and wear resistance, helping metal components to last longer. It also allows parts to better cope with repeated stress and prevents them from wearing out too fast. Another big plus is that it normally changes shape very little, which is helpful for precision parts.
The main difference is the medium used for the treatment. In gas nitriding, the medium is an ammonia-based gas, and in liquid nitriding, a salt bath. Both are used to harden the surface, but gas nitriding is often preferred when better control and cleaner processing are desired for industrial parts.
The hardness after nitriding depends on the metal, the process used, and the depth of treatment. In some cases, the surface can become very hard. However, exact hardness varies from part to part, so it is always best to check with respect to the material and application.
Gas nitriding involves heating the part in a furnace and exposing it to a nitrogen-bearing gas (usually ammonia), whereby nitrogen diffuses into the surface. The gas supplies the nitrogen. The heat makes the diffusion process possible. This is why the furnace must keep both temperature and atmosphere under close control for a good result.
